**Facilities Ticket — Shared Lab B2**

Heads up for contractors working in Lab B2 this week: we share the space with the Quillon Optics team, so keep the partition curtain closed and don't move their rigs. Hard hats off inside the clean zone, please. The side door sticks a bit — push firmly. Entry code for the lab is below.

door code, yagap-bahof: bdg-O-05

## Step 3: Configure the Autocomplete Widget

Plugin authors embedding the Wrenfold address autocomplete must set AUTOCOMPLETE_REGION and AUTOCOMPLETE_LOCALE in their plugin's .env file. Debounce defaults to 250ms and rarely needs changing. Requests to the Wrenfold lookup service are authenticated per plugin, so place your issued credential on the next line:

sealed setting: ARCHIVE_KEY3=8d0

Quick note for the sync: the Burrowlink dashboard keeps dropping its websocket after ~90s idle, and the reconnect loop hammers the gateway instead of backing off. Tamsin has a fix with jittered retries landing this week. If you want to repro locally against the staging relay, authenticate with the key below.

gateway credential: kto23_LX9A4ys6i4nzHtpOLNLodKK

Crashfall is Lumawork's crash-report pipeline for the Pebbleline mobile app. Symbolication runs on the Vexbury cluster; reports land in the triage queue within two minutes. Release managers only need the ingest worker configured before cutting a build. Clone the crashfall-worker repo, copy env.sample to .env, and set the upload token on the line that follows.

sealed setting: VAULT_KEY20=c8ea1e419912889df6b4

Ticket QRX-4412: Signature check failing on password-reset service. Context for onboarding: the Lanternwell reset flow was revamped last sprint, and the new token service now verifies every deploy bundle before rollout. Since Tuesday, the Corvid staging verifier rejects our bundles with a signature mismatch. We traced it to the old key being retired during the revamp. To unblock, re-sign the bundle locally and push again through the Fennic gate. Use the current signing key, which is included below.

rollout seal: bky4_yke3